During the festive Qurbani season of Eid-ul-Azha, the business of metalworkers picks up as people flock to them to have their knives sharpened. Dialogue Pakistan reaches out to a 60-year-old blacksmith in Karachi who has been working since the age of 12. He shares the hardships of his trade, explaining how much of his work involves handling fire with his bare hands.

 

“We are facing hell here—may Allah reward us in heaven for our efforts,” the blacksmith says, lamenting how his hard work often goes unrecognized.
